ZIP code 32966 is a mid-sized community (a standard USPS delivery area) in Vero Beach, Indian River County, Florida, home to 15,626 residents across 754.9 square miles, a density of 21 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.

ZIP 32966 reports a modest median household income of $66,771 (13% below the average Florida ZIP), while per-capita income is $45,583. The poverty rate is 8.7%, with unemployment at 4.7%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$294,200 (22% below the average Florida ZIP), and median rent is $1,609; owner occupancy is 74.9%.

A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 33.9%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 63, and the average commute is 23 minutes. What businesses operate in this ZIP?

Census Bureau data shows 514 business establishments in ZIP 32966, employing approximately 7,271 people with a combined annual payroll of $267,142,000.
